Brownsdale, MN vs Hanley Falls, MN
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Hanley Falls is 16.7% cheaper than Brownsdale. With a cost index of 59 vs 69,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Hanley Falls to Brownsdale should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Brownsdale is $788/month compared to $628/month in Hanley Falls — a 26%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Hanley Falls is more affordable at $76,700 median vs $137,600.
Median household income in Brownsdale is $76,500 compared to $57,917 in Hanley Falls (+32.1%). While Brownsdale is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Brownsdale spend roughly 12.4% of their income on rent, less than the 13% in Hanley Falls.
